Switching From Cymbalta To Limbrel For Osteoarthritis

I am currently taking Cymbalta for my osteoarthritis, but really can't tell if it helps any. I realize I will have to be taken off the Cymbalta slowly by my doctor. However, I wonder if I might be able to start Limbrel while being "weaned off" of the Cymbalta? Would that be safe?

I didn't find any problems, or interactions listed, but the ultimate decision is up to you and your physician.

The FDA lists the typical side effects of Limbrel as possibly including upset stomach, gas, and diarrhea.
